网页加载速度是影响用户体验和搜索引擎排名的重要因素。随着移动互联网和在线服务的快速发展,用户对网页响应能力的期望越来越高。如果网页加载缓慢,不仅会导致用户流失,还会损害品牌形象,降低搜索引擎的表现。掌握网络优化的技巧,提升网页加载速度尤为重要。本文将分享十大优化技巧,帮助网站提升性能。

1. 压缩图片与文件
大容量的图片和文件会显著增加网页加载时间。通过使用合适的格式(如JPEG、PNG、WebP)和工具,可以有效压缩图片文件,减少占用的带宽。使用Gzip压缩技术来压缩CSS、HTML和JavaScript文件,同样能够显著提高加载速度。
2. 利用浏览器缓存
浏览器缓存能够存储部分静态资源,使得用户再次访问时无需重新下载。设置合适的缓存策略,通过HTTP头部指定缓存过期时间,能够大幅提高网页加载速度。
3. 精简HTML/CSS/JavaScript
代码的简洁性关系到网页的加载效率。去除无用的代码和注释,合并和缩小文件,都可以减少网络请求的时间和文件大小。工具如UglifyJS和CSSNano可以辅助完成这项任务。
4. 使用内容分发网络(CDN)
CDN通过分布在全球各地的服务器,将网站内容传递到离用户最近的节点,能有效缩短延迟。选择合适的CDN服务提供商,可以极大提升全球访问的响应速度。
5. 减少HTTP请求
每次加载网页时,浏览器都会向服务器发送多个HTTP请求。合并CSS和JavaScript文件,使用CSS Sprites,将多张小图合并处理,能够显著减少请求次数,加快加载速度。
6. 优化服务器性能
选择适合的主机配置和优化服务器设置,可以提高加载速度。使用现代服务器技术如HTTP/2,支持并行连接,能提高数据传输效率,同时考虑使用反向代理技术来分担服务器负担。
7. 延迟加载
对页面中的图片和其他重量级元素进行延迟加载,意味着在用户滚动到这些元素时再进行加载。这样可以减少初始加载的资源,提升用户的体验,尤其适用于内容丰富的页面。
8. 优化字体加载
网页中的字体文件也会影响加载速度。选择合适的字体格式,例如WOFF和WOFF2,并通过使用字体显示策略(如font-display: swap)来优化加载,确保用户能够更快看到内容。
9. 使用异步加载
对于非关键的JavaScript文件,可以使用异步加载方式。使用`async`或`defer`属性来确保这些文件在页面加载后再进行解析,减少对初始加载的影响。
10. 定期进行性能测试
网站的性能不是一成不变的,定期进行性能测试可以帮助发现潜在的问题。使用工具如Google PageSpeed Insights、GTmetrix等,能够具体分析网页的加载时间和性能瓶颈,并提供优化建议。
浏览器的加载速度直接影响用户的体验和网站的转化率,采取有效的优化策略至关重要。随着技术的进步,持续关注性能优化的新趋势和技术,才能保持竞争力。
常见问题解答(FAQ)
1. 网页加载速度慢的常见原因是什么?
- 常见原因包括大文件资源、过多HTTP请求、服务器响应时间过长等。
2. 如何检查网站的加载速度?
- 使用工具如Google PageSpeed Insights、GTmetrix、Pingdom等,可以方便地分析网站的加载速度和性能。
3. 内容分发网络(CDN)有什么优点?
- CDN能够缩短距离用户的服务器响应时间,提高页面加载速度,减轻原服务器负担,并提高网站的可用性。
4. 保持网页快速加载需要多久进行一次优化?
- 建议定期每季度进行一次性能检测和优化,根据网站的更新频率和流量情况决定是否更频繁地检查。
5. 图片压缩会影响质量吗?
- 合理压缩的图片可以在很少影响质量的同时显著降低文件大小。在使用工具时选择适当的压缩级别,确保质量与性能之间的平衡。
